The Cotswold Lady is a lovely two bedroom dog friendly property situated in the quintessential Cotswold village of Guiting Power. Boasting stylish furnishings and an enviable position above The Cotswold Guy farm shop, this home away from home is an ideal bolthole for those looking for a retreat in the Cotswold countryside.

The Cotswold area
-------------------------
I have travelled most of England, Scotland, and Wales over the last 51 years. I find The Cotswolds one of the most beautiful and attractive areas in Britain. I love the long-stretched hills ("the wolds"), the woods, the green pastures with sheep and horses, the alone-standing trees in the fields with blue woodpigeons flying to-and-fro, and the unique walls in Cotswold Stone surrounding the fields. I like the many streams with the occasional ford that tests if your car is watertight. I like the narrow country roads, where you need to give way to one another and you sometimes have to reverse your car to let the car coming towards you pass, and the friendly raised hand in acknowledgement. The many small and beautiful villages with houses built in beautiful yellow Cotswold Stone from local quarries. The village, Guiting Power
-----------------------------------
This beautiful village is "my" village. It is a typical Cotswold village with lots of footpaths round the area. Guiting is where most of my English friends live. Having just finished Grammar School in Denmark I first came to the village as a 17-year old youth back in 1972, and I have been back countless times over the years. In those days Guiting was a little different. The village had Miles Garage in Tally Ho Lane, where you could have your car serviced and buy petrol. This was where I enjoyed my stays with Anne and Chris Miles. In those days you served the petrol to the customers. This was one of my jobs, so I got to know many of the people in the village, when they came for petrol. There was also a Post Office in the Village Square. This has now been turned into a cosy café. The Sweet Shop, also in the Village Square, where I went to buy sweets has gone. The village had no less than two pubs – and still does! The Farmers Arms and The Olde Inn (now The Hollow Bottom). The Olde Inn was my favourite pub in those days, and I even had the pleasure of help serving behind the bar one Saturday night back in July 1972.
The Village also had a Bakery. The Watsons ran the place. First floor of the Bakery building has now been turned into the apartment "The Cotswold Lady" that you can rent for your holidays. The ground floor holds the shop "The Cotswold Guy", where you can buy fresh vegetables, milk, bread, and other daily essentials.
